In a rather interesting turn of events, Volkswagen’s Electrify America has decided to purchase and install Tesla Powerpacks at over 100 of its charging stations. In an announcement on Monday, Electrify America stated that the Powerpacks would be installed to help during peak charging times. The battery storage units, which are expected to be installed this year, would have a capacity of 350 kWh and be compatible with 210 kW rapid charging.

The deployment of Tesla Powerpacks to the Electrify America network mirrors the concept utilized by Tesla in its Superchargers. That said, the deal between Tesla and Volkswagen could be seen as proof that even competitors in the electric car industry could work together for a common goal. In a statement to The Verge, for one, Electrify America CEO Giovanni Palazzo noted that Tesla’s industrial-grade batteries are a “natural fit” for his company’s charging stations, considering the Silicon Valley-based carmaker’s expertise on charging networks.

“With our chargers offering high power levels, it makes sense for us to use batteries at our most high demand stations for peak shaving to operate more efficiently. Tesla’s Powerpack system is a natural fit given their global expertise in both battery storage development and EV charging,” the CEO said.

The addition of Tesla Powerpacks to Electrify America is coming at the perfect time, considering that Volkswagen’s charging network is set to support a number of electric vehicles that are coming to the market in the near future. Later this year, for one, the Porsche Taycan is expected to start production, and as mentioned by the German carmaker in a recent press release, the premium electric sedan would be utilizing Electrify America as its partner for coast-to-coast travel in the United States.

Volkswagen has ambitious plans for Electrify America. The network plans to have 3,000 chargers online by the middle of 2019, though only 89 are operational for now. The charging network also fell prey to a shutdown last month when safety concerns emerged from the cables used in the system. If any, the addition of Tesla’s Powerpacks would likely allow Electrify America to deliver more consistent, dependable service to its users.

Tesla says it will officially inaugurate its new Semi factory in Nevada next month. The Tesla Semi account posted the announcement on X, sharing a graphic titled “Semi Rollout” with a date of September 24. No further details were given about the format of the event or who would attend.

While Tesla’s dedicated Semi plant in Sparks, adjacent to Gigafactory Nevada, opened back in April, with the first trucks rolling off the high volume line on April 29, the timing for the factory inauguration comes at a surprise. The ribbon cutting event five months into production is a break from how Tesla has usually handled its other factories, where the first truck or car off the line typically served as the milestone moment.

The 1.7 million square foot factory was built as part of a $3.6 billion expansion Tesla announced in early 2023, and it shares a site with the battery cell lines that feed the Semi’s structural pack, a decision meant to remove the supply bottleneck that delayed the truck for years. The plant is designed for 50,000 trucks a year at full ramp. Semi program director Dan Priestley has said production “is now ramping” rather than claiming it has reached scale.

Nine years passed between the Semi’s 2017 unveiling and this stage of production, with the truck slipping from an original 2019 target through hand built pilot units for PepsiCo and a slow build out of the Nevada plant. An inauguration event now gives Tesla a stage to talk up that ramp and reset expectations for how many trucks it can begin delivering at scale.

The September date also lines up with the Semi’s next milestone. Tesla confirmed the truck is heading to Europe with a full unveiling at the IAA Transportation trade show in Hannover, Germany, running September 15 through 20. Between the Nevada event and the Hannover reveal, Tesla has roughly a week and a half in September to make the case that the Semi is now a truck being built and sold on two continents rather than tested in a handful of fleets.

Tesla Energy has introduced the Powerwall Lease in conjunction with Tesla Electric, making the service available in Texas. This new option delivers whole-home backup power using two Powerwall units for a net monthly cost of $35 after credits, accompanied by a low fixed electricity rate.

Under the lease terms, customers pay a one-time order fee of $100. The base lease payment for the two Powerwalls is approximately $122 per month during the first year, subject to a 3 percent annual escalator thereafter. Enrollment in a qualifying Tesla Electric Backup plan or Virtual Power Plant plan provides an $87 monthly credit.

This credit lowers the effective cost to roughly $35 per month plus applicable tax.

Installation of the standard system carries no additional charge. The package features Storm Watch for outage protection and allows complete management through a single Tesla application. The system supplies continuous whole-home backup capability.

The Powerwall system enables households to maintain electricity during severe storms that disrupt the utility grid. When outages occur, the batteries automatically provide seamless backup power to the home.

Tesla Storm Watch monitors weather forecasts and ensures the units are fully charged ahead of anticipated severe weather events so that power remains available throughout the disruption, keeping lights, refrigeration, and other essential systems operating without interruption.

Availability is restricted to select Texas locations where retail electric choice exists. Participants must lease exactly two Powerwall units and maintain continuous enrollment with Tesla Electric. Solar panels cannot be included under this particular lease arrangement.

The monthly credit activates automatically once the system is installed, receives permission to operate, and enrollment is confirmed. To retain the credit, customers are required to stay enrolled in Tesla Electric and fulfill all program conditions.

Nonstandard installations that involve electrical upgrades or special permitting may lead to extra expenses and might impact eligibility for the credit, so be sure to check with either your installer or Tesla to ensure you will still qualify.

Tesla has filed paperwork in Texas for a second massive manufacturing project in the same week it locked down its chip fabrication site, this time for a $10.1 billion solar cell plant in Fort Bend County. The filing, submitted July 22 under the state’s Jobs, Energy, Technology and Innovation Act and first surfaced by Sawyer Merritt on X, lists an internal project name of “Project Crystal Sun” and targets a site off FM 762 and FM 1994 near Richmond, about 40 minutes outside Houston.

The application, prepared by Kroll Tax Services on Tesla’s behalf, spans five parcels totaling roughly 3,000 acres within the Lamar Consolidated Independent School District. Tesla wants a 10 year property tax limitation in exchange for the investment, split as $1.5 billion in real property and $8.6 billion in equipment and personal property. The company projects 9,712 permanent jobs once the plant reaches full operation, with 1,147 peak construction jobs during a build window running from this year through 2028 and commercial operations targeted for the first quarter of 2029.

Tesla is not fully committed to Fort Bend County yet. The filing states the company is weighing the site against an unnamed out of state alternative, and frames the tax abatement as what would make Texas competitive against that option. If the district and county decline the incentive, Tesla says it may build elsewhere.

The plant would handle the full solar cell production chain in one facility, according to the filing, covering wafer and ingot manufacturing, coating, metallization and printing lines, cell testing, automated material handling and cleanroom infrastructure. That scope points to Tesla vertically integrating a part of its supply chain it currently sources largely from overseas partners, mirroring the approach behind its expanding Megapack production in Brookshire, Texas, where Tesla has already built out two buildings for its grid battery business.

The timing lines up closely with Tesla and SpaceX’s other big Texas commitment this month. SpaceX confirmed its Terafab chip factory would land in Grimes County days before this filing surfaced, with construction on that $16.8 billion project starting almost immediately after local officials met with residents. Terafab is meant to produce the AI chips running Tesla’s Optimus robots and Full Self-Driving software, while a solar cell plant would feed a different part of the business, the panels and storage systems Tesla sells to homeowners, businesses and utilities, and increasingly needs to power its own data centers.

Musk has talked about building domestic solar manufacturing capacity before, tying it to the amount of power Tesla’s AI ambitions will require.
